It's Important to Understand EEAT Is Significant Now Than Ever (and Steps to Implement It) The growing importance of EEAT (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ness ) simply be overstated, particularly in today's digital landscape. Google's changing search algorithms are increasingly focused on delivering excellent and helpful content to users , and EEAT serves as a vital indicator of that quality. Previously , signals like keyword density and link building held more weight, but now, Google's assessors – both people and automated – are evaluating the general expertise of the content creator, the reputation of the website, and the assurance that users can place in the details presented. To improve your EEAT, prioritize creating thoroughly investigated content by skilled authors, cultivate relationships with established sources in your niche, and ensure that your website is precise , up-to-date , and transparent about its qualifications .
